Overview Females are physically distinct from males, and therefore have different physical ‘resources’ with which to play the game. This means that whilst the fundamentals of padel remain the same for both sexes, the way in which female players maximise their ability differs from males. This practical workshop, developed by worldclass padel players and coaches, is applicable to all ages and stages of female players and provides the tools to optimise your players’ improvement, whilst also minimising their risk of injury.
